4.3
Absolute encoder (SSI), multiturn
General
The parameter assignment of a multiturn absolute encoder (SSI) illustrated in the following
example is performed using the "External encoder" technology object.
If the encoder belongs permanently to an axis, the "Axis" technology object is used to assign
parameters.
Note
In conjunction with ADI4, SIMOTION only supports encoders with 13-bit and 25-bit message
frames.
